智能相机量产必验项:高通 QCS610 边缘 AI 推理的 FCT 产测策略优化
·

边缘视觉设备的产测盲区及深度优化方案
智能相机在边缘 AI 推理场景的直通率波动问题,已经成为工业视觉领域普遍存在的痛点。根据行业调研数据,约63%的质量问题源于FCT(Functional Circuit Test)阶段对NPU算力与内存带宽的测试覆盖不足。以某工业读码器项目为例,初期直通率仅72%,经过详细故障树分析(FTA)发现,QCS610的INT8量化模型在产线高温环境下的推理稳定性缺陷是主要原因。
核心矛盾:算力验证 vs 测试成本的系统化解决方案
1. 动态负载模拟缺失的工程验证方案
目前行业普遍存在的测试盲区是仅运行静态图像分类,而实际工业场景需要持续处理30fps的视频流。通过设计对比实验,我们发现了显著差异:
| 测试模式 | 峰值内存带宽 | NPU 利用率 | 故障检出率 | 典型应用场景 |
|---|---|---|---|---|
| 静态图片(JPEG) | 2.1GB/s | 35% | 12% | 简单OCR识别 |
| 动态视频(H.264) | 4.8GB/s | 89% | 68% | 产线物品追踪 |
| 多路视频(4x720p) | 6.4GB/s | 97% | 82% | 智能安防监控 |
实验数据表明,测试负载越接近真实场景,故障检出率越高。建议产测方案应至少包含: - 基础测试:单路1080p@30fps视频流 - 压力测试:双路1080p@30fps视频流 - 极限测试:四路720p@30fps视频流(可选)
2. 温度-性能耦合建模的完整方案
QCS610的NPU在高温环境下存在明显的性能衰减现象。我们实测了不同温度下的NPU时钟频率:
| 环境温度(°C) | NPU时钟频率(MHz) | 推理延迟(ms) | 功耗(W) |
|---|---|---|---|
| 25 | 800 | 28.5 | 2.1 |
| 45 | 750 | 30.2 | 2.3 |
| 65 | 700 | 33.1 | 2.6 |
| 85 | 600 | 38.7 | 2.9 |
对应的产测脚本应升级为:
# 增强版温控测试脚本
def thermal_test(model, stream):
temp_steps = [25, 45, 65, 85] # 测试温度梯度
results = []
for temp in temp_steps:
set_thermal_zone(temp)
stabilize(120) # 稳定120秒
latency = benchmark_model(model, stream)
power = measure_power()
results.append((temp, latency, power))
assert latency < 33ms # 产线标准阈值
return results
3. 多模块协同测试的完整方案
当使用ES7210麦克风阵列时,我们发现I2S时钟与NPU推理存在时序冲突。通过分析500台样机数据,总结出以下故障模式:
| 故障类型 | 发生率 | 根本原因 | 解决方案 |
|---|---|---|---|
| 音频中断 | 17% | I2S时钟抖动>8ns | 优化时钟树布局 |
| 视频卡顿 | 9% | 内存带宽不足 | 增加DDR压力测试 |
| NPU死锁 | 4% | 温度触发的时钟降频 | 加强散热设计 |
可复现的优化方案实施细节
1. 视频流压力测试标准流程
- 测试准备:
- 硬件:搭建温控测试箱(-20°C~85°C)
- 软件:部署FFmpeg 4.3+和AISight监控工具
- 测试执行:
ffmpeg -re -i test.h264 -c copy -f h264 udp://127.0.0.1:1234 - 监控指标:
- NPU利用率持续>85%的时长
- 内存带宽峰值波动范围
- 帧处理延迟的99分位值
2. 温循测试增强方案
| 测试阶段 | 温度范围 | 循环次数 | 验证指标 | 合格标准 |
|---|---|---|---|---|
| ICT后 | -20°C~65°C | 3次 | 启动时间 | <5秒 |
| FCT前 | 25°C~85°C | 5次 | 模型输出相似度 | ≥0.98 |
| 终检前 | 40°C~85°C | 2次 | 无硬件损伤 | 外观检测无异常 |
3. 跨模块协同测试实施要点
- 同步触发机制:
- 使用硬件触发器同时启动NPU推理和I2S采集
- 设置PTP时钟同步精度<100ns
- 测试判据:
- 音频中断次数<3次/10分钟
- 视频帧丢失率<0.1%
- 系统整体功耗波动<15%
成本与收益的详细分析
1. BOM成本优化方案
| 改进项 | 基础方案成本 | 优化方案成本 | 节省金额 |
|---|---|---|---|
| 散热垫片 | $0.85 | $0.45 | $0.40 |
| 温控电路 | $1.20 | $0.90 | $0.30 |
| 测试夹具 | $150 | $80 | $70 |
2. 直通率提升案例分析
某汽车零部件检测项目实施前后对比:
| 指标 | 改进前 | 改进后 | 提升幅度 |
|---|---|---|---|
| 直通率 | 72% | 89% | +17% |
| 平均测试时间 | 85s | 68s | -20% |
| 误判率 | 6.5% | 1.2% | -5.3% |
3. 全生命周期成本测算
以年产量10万台计算:
| 成本项 | 改进前 | 改进后 | 三年节省 |
|---|---|---|---|
| 测试成本 | $280,000 | $210,000 | $210,000 |
| 售后返修 | $150,000 | $45,000 | $315,000 |
| 品牌损失(估算) | $80,000 | $15,000 | $195,000 |
行业最佳实践建议: 1. 消费级设备可采用"65°C+动态视频"的平衡方案,测试周期可控制在45秒内 2. 工业级设备必须执行85°C完整测试,建议采用并行测试架构提升效率 3. 医疗等特殊领域需增加-40°C低温测试项
更多推荐



所有评论(0)